Subject: [GIT PULL] perf/urgent for 6.1-rc6
Date: Sun, 20 Nov 2022 12:24:34 +0100	[thread overview]
Message-ID: <Y3oOcqhGQqpH7xtd@zn.tnic> (raw)

Hi Linus,

please pull a couple of urgent perf fixes for 6.1.

Thx.

---

The following changes since commit f0c4d9fc9cc9462659728d168387191387e903cc:

  Linux 6.1-rc4 (2022-11-06 15:07:11 -0800)

are available in the Git repository at:

  git://git.kernel.org/pub/scm/linux/kernel/git/tip/tip.git tags/perf_urgent_for_v6.1_rc6

for you to fetch changes up to ce0d998be9274dd3a3d971cbeaa6fe28fd2c3062:

  perf/x86/intel/pt: Fix sampling using single range output (2022-11-16 10:12:59 +0100)

----------------------------------------------------------------
- Fix an intel PT erratum where CPUs do not support single range output
for more than 4K

- Fix a NULL ptr dereference which can happen after an NMI interferes
with the event enabling dance in amd_pmu_enable_all()

- Free the events array too when freeing uncore contexts on CPU online,
  thereby fixing a memory leak

- Improve the pending SIGTRAP check
